diff options
| author | Edvard Thörnros <edvard.thornros@gmail.com> | 2021-01-14 23:25:15 +0100 |
|---|---|---|
| committer | Gustav Sörnäs <gustav@sornas.net> | 2021-01-15 16:58:08 +0100 |
| commit | 71c3e64fc732d87e043ba4fb21716b3194678051 (patch) | |
| tree | f581b0d1d876425e3d8a489dae5046b64af9b2c7 /src | |
| parent | 7ec991b8d6654aaf27a005804347346e16500a47 (diff) | |
| download | sylt-71c3e64fc732d87e043ba4fb21716b3194678051.tar.gz | |
Nicer prints for function types
Diffstat (limited to 'src')
| -rw-r--r-- | src/typer.rs |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/src/typer.rs b/src/typer.rs index 99f5487..f5b0e00 100644 --- a/src/typer.rs +++ b/src/typer.rs @@ -131,8 +131,8 @@ impl VM { print!(" "); } match s { + Type::Function(block) => print!("Function({:?} -> {:?})", block.args.green(), block.ret.green()), s => print!("{:?}", s.green()), - Type::Function(block) => print!("Function({:?} -> {:?})", block.args, block.ret), } } println!("]"); |
